They’re home! LAUNDRY DAY finished out their We Switched Bodies Tour with a sold-out hometown show right here in New York City at Irving Plaza, and we got to head out to see it!

They were joined by fellow NYC rock band Quarters of Change, to open the show. They killed it! The crowd (and us, obv) loved every second of their set. From the absolute power behind ‘Jaded’ to the insane vocals in their newest single, ‘T Love,’ there was something for everyone! They’re true rockstars, definitely ones to keep an eye on.

Hometown Headliners

LAUNDRY DAY took the stage next. The crowd was electric! Anyone and everyone was at this show, whether they were 5 or 85, they were there – and dancing!

Not only was it their biggest show ever, but since it was a hometown show, they got to see a lot of familiar faces in the crowd. They were definitely feeling the energy, they played the whole night with huge smiles on their faces having the time of their lives!

The band truly has an incredible amount of talent. And their versatility? Unmatched. They pulled out an acoustic version of ‘The Knots’ in the middle of the set that caught everyone’s undivided attention. Really, really, really good music. Like… really.

We’re so grateful to have had the chance to spend the last show of LAUNDRY DAY’s tour, at home in New York City with them! We’re still tired from dancing all night.
